Permits Issued for Three-Story Residence at 1935 East Harold Street in East Kensington

Permits have been issued for the construction of a three-story single-family residence at 1935 East Harold Street, located in East Kensington, Philadelphia. The development site sits between East Albert Street and Jasper Street, just north of East Huntingdon Street and in close proximity to the Market-Frankford line’s Huntingdon Station. The proposed structure will span a total of 1,151 square feet. Urban Renewal Builders LLC is listed as the general contractor. The architectural design has been prepared by Marshall Sabatini Architecture +.

Permits Issued for 45-Unit Mixed-Use Development at 4225 North Park Avenue in Hunting Park, North Philadelphia

Permits have been issued for the construction of a four-story mixed-use building at 4225-27 North Park Avenue in the Hunting Park neighborhood of North Philadelphia. Located on the west side of the block between West Bristol Street and West Luzerne Street, the project will bring 45 residential units and ground-floor office space to a currently vacant site.

Permits Issued for Two-Story Single-Family Home at 2120 East Orleans Street in Kensington, Philadelphia

Permits have been issued for the construction of a two-story single-family residence at 2120 East Orleans Street in Kensington, Philadelphia. The new structure is planned for the south side of the block between Amber Street and Belmore Street, replacing a vacant lot in a residential section of the neighborhood. The architectural design is being led Toner Architecture, Inc., who is also listed as the design professional in responsible charge. The project is being developed by New Kensington Community Development Corporation (NKCDC), with construction managed by KAPS Construction LLC.

Permits Issued for Two-Story Single-Family Home at 2138 East Orleans Street in Kensington, Philadelphia

Permits have been issued for the construction of a two-story single-family residence at 2138 East Orleans Street in Kensington, Philadelphia. The structure will rise on the south side of the block between Amber Street and Elkhart Street, replacing a vacant lot in a residential corridor of East Kensington. The project is being developed by New Kensington Community Development Corporation (NKCDC) in collaboration with contractor KAPS Construction LLC. Ian Toner of Toner Architecture, Inc. is listed as both the architect and design professional in responsible charge.

Permits Issued for Single-Family Home at 1811 Willington Street in North Central Philadelphia

Permits have been issued for the construction of a four-story single-family residence at 1811 Willington Street in North Central Philadelphia. The structure is planned for a currently vacant lot on the east side of the block between West Berks Street and West Montgomery Avenue, in close proximity to Temple University. The new development will bring a contemporary infill addition to a residential block lined with traditional two-story rowhouses. The property is owned by Oleksandr Kopa and designed by Plato A. Marinakos Jr. Architect, LLC. Construction will be carried out by SL Construction LLC.
